Transaction 56994bf21e895978089e36882af0a345cf136944dd7927d0289c9e3cd48664e3
1 Input
2 Outputs
- 56994bf21e895978089e36882af0a345cf136944dd7927d0289c9e3cd48664e3:0
- 56994bf21e895978089e36882af0a345cf136944dd7927d0289c9e3cd48664e3:1
value 4000000
address 33Ve7UUBms2XwRYGLsmFqDyZxeuz82NfKf
value 5153212
address 1EdUCCcVdAwpnfFDiAyseFwFuL1UxqynrC